What Is Dearness Allowance and Why It Matters

Dearness Allowance is a cost of living adjustment paid to government employees and pensioners. It forms a crucial part of the salary structure because it directly compensates employees for the increase in prices of everyday items like food, transportation, housing, and utilities.

The allowance is revised twice every year. The first revision generally comes into effect from January, while the second revision is implemented from July. The calculation of DA is based on inflation trends measured through the Consumer Price Index. When inflation rises, DA is increased to ensure employees are not negatively affected by higher costs.

For millions of central government employees, a DA hike means an increase in their overall salary without requiring changes in their basic pay. Pensioners also benefit as the same percentage increase is applied to their pensions.

Estimated Impact of the New DA Rate

The latest increase may appear small in percentage terms, but the actual impact on salaries can be quite significant when applied to the basic pay of employees.

Below is an overview of how DA revisions typically affect salary structures.

ComponentBefore DA HikeAfter DA Hike (Estimated)
Basic Pay₹40,000₹40,000
DA Rate50%54%
DA Amount₹20,000₹21,600
Total Salary₹60,000₹61,600

Even a four percent increase in Dearness Allowance can add thousands of rupees annually to the income of government employees. For senior employees with higher basic pay, the benefit becomes even more substantial.

How the Government Calculates DA

The calculation of Dearness Allowance is based on a formula linked to the Consumer Price Index for Industrial Workers. The CPI measures changes in the price level of a basket of goods and services consumed by households. When the index rises due to inflation, the DA percentage also increases. Government experts and finance officials analyze inflation trends before recommending a revision. The final decision is approved by the Union Cabinet.

This transparent method ensures that the allowance remains aligned with real economic conditions and protects employees from inflationary pressures.

Impact on Pensioners and Retired Employees

The DA revision does not only benefit active government employees. Pensioners also receive Dearness Relief, which is directly linked to the same percentage increase applied to DA.

This means retired employees who depend on pensions will experience an increase in their monthly income as well. For many pensioners, this adjustment is crucial because inflation affects their fixed income more significantly. The increase helps them manage healthcare expenses, daily necessities, and other living costs more comfortably.
